YSL Beauty Expands Into China
By SENATUS News | 17 April 2013

L'Oréal Luxe which owns YSL Beauty, the cosmetic brand that bears the name of the separate fashion label, Saint Laurent, has announced plans to expand into China, to meet the demands of beauty and skin care in the country. Come May, YSL Beauty to open it's first retail counter in Isetan's Shanghai branch, located on on Nanjing Road.

"We want to keep innovating and surprising the Chinese consumer. Yves Saint Laurent is a beautiful brand that belongs to French haute couture. Chinese consumers, they want the best," said Nicolas Hieronimus, president of L'Oréal Luxe.

"In this country, the sky has no limit because the Chinese have such an appetite for luxury that we can only be excited for the future," Hieronimus added, "This is just the beginning."

In future, expect to see special editions of YSL fragrance, makeup, and skin-care lines targeted for the Chinese consumer, which the company expects to be its largest market by 2015.
